Description

An immaculate and stylish one-bedroom 2nd floor apartment (with lift) situated in the heart of Woodbridge, just steps from the Thoroughfare and Elmhurst Park public garden.

Accessed via a secure entry system, with front and back entrances, rear car parking and communal gardens. Upon entering the apartment, the hallway offers two useful storage cupboards, one housing the hot water tank. To the right, the modern shower room is fitted with a wall hung low-level WC, a bowl style wash hand basin, and a walk in shower cubicle.

The well-proportioned bedroom enjoys a front-facing window, flooding the space with natural light, and benefits from a deep built-in double wardrobe.

The sitting/dining room is spacious and bright, offering a pleasant south west facing outlook towards Woodbridge town, the marina, park and fields beyond. A feature chimney breast houses a flame effect electric fire. An open-plan layout leads seamlessly into the kitchen, which is equipped with a range of easy access pull out base units, Stainless steel sink and tap with a stainless steel canopy extractor over an induction hob and multi function oven.

Room Dimensions:

Shower Room – 7' 06" x 4' 10" (2.29m x 1.47m)

Bedroom – 14' 0" x 9' 02" (4.27m x 2.79m)

Sitting/Dining Room – 16' 10" x 10' 01" (5.13m x 3.07m)

Kitchen – 7' 09" x 6' 10" (2.36m x 2.08m)

Prime Location:

Suffolk Place is ideally positioned just a short walk from Woodbridge’s Thoroughfare, offering a variety of independent shops, cafés, and restaurants. The historic town also provides excellent amenities, including:
Medical centres, Cinema, Swimming pool.

Woodbridge railway station with connections to Ipswich and London Liverpool Street.
